This four-bedroom semi-detached house is available to let in Charlton Kings, Cheltenham. The property offers one reception room, a separate dining area and a fitted kitchen, providing defined spaces for day-to-day living and mealtimes. There is a family bathroom serving the bedrooms. Ample off-road parking is available to the front, and a garage is included, offering additional storage.
Located in Charlton Kings, the house sits within a residential area on the edge of Cheltenham, with access to local shops, cafés and amenities in the village centre and along the nearby routes into town. Cheltenham town centre provides a wider range of retail, leisure and dining facilities.
Public transport options include Cheltenham Spa railway station, which offers direct services to Gloucester, Bristol, Birmingham and London. Typical journey times are around 10–15 minutes to Gloucester, approximately 40–50 minutes to Bristol, about 40–50 minutes to Birmingham and around 2–2.5 hours to London Paddington. Local bus services operate between Charlton Kings and Cheltenham town centre, connecting to the wider area.
Charlton Kings is known for its access to local schools and to green spaces around the south-eastern side of Cheltenham, with parks and walking routes available in the surrounding area and towards the Cotswold escarpment.
This property is to let and is available now, offering four bedrooms, one reception room, a separate dining area, one kitchen, a bathroom, ample off-road parking and a garage in a residential setting within Charlton Kings, Cheltenham.
